#47b840 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#47b840 is composed of 27.8% red, 72.2%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.2%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 116.5 degrees, a saturation of 48.4% and a lightness of 48.6%. #47b840 color hex could be obtained by blending #8eff80 with #007100.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

Shades and Tints of #47b840

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040903 is the darkest color, while #fafdf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#47b840

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a7f79 is the less saturated color, while #14f107 is the most saturated one.
